LAHORE: The Lahore High Court (LHC) sought on Wednesday the proposals from the Punjab Health Department to set up separate hospital wards for transgender persons.
Justice Ali Akbar Qureshi heard a petition regarding the establishment of the separate wards for transgender persons.
Earlier, the petition was filed by Advocate Ishtiaq Chaudhry.

During today’s hearing session, the court remarked that the transgender persons are God’s creation and can be born in any family.
The LHC then noted that a separate room must be reserved for transgender persons in all state-run hospitals.
Afterward, the court ordered the Punjab Health Department to submit its suggestions on providing healthcare facilities to transgender persons by September 26.
The judge then observed that the recommendations must be implemented before September 30.
